Today, on GreenTech Amsterdam’s opening, the 2023 GreenTech Awards winners were announced. Skytree wins the Concept Award for product Model 5. And Biobest, in collaboration with PATS, wins the Innovation Award for the product Trap-Eye™. 

Jolanda Heistek (chairman jury) explains why: “The winners of the Concept & Innovation Awards were selected based on the originality of the entry, the level of sustainability and the impact on social and environmental issues. Both had a very professional way of presenting which gave the jury confidence in their development journey and business plans”.

THE GREENTECH CONCEPT AWARD GOES TO: Model 5 by Skytree

Product: Skytree’s DDAC technology captures CO2 directly from the air and allows it to be commercially utilised or permanently stored.
Product Description: Skytree provides Decentralised Direct Air Capture (DDAC) units that offer a scalable alternative to the current fossil fuel-based CO2 supply chain. The DDAC units enable businesses to extract clean CO2 directly from ambient air on-site for either direct usage or permanent storage. This approach satisfies the demand for CO2 while decreasing the concentration of CO2 in the atmosphere.
In the jury comments, Heistek says: “This new technology of a startup is uniquely positioned to address several societal and environmental issues and can have a positive effect on the ecological footprint of horticulture. This crossover technology has the potential to revolutionizing effect on limiting fossil fuel based CO2.”

THE GREENTECH INNOVATION AWARD GOES TO: Trap-Eye™ by Biobest in collaboration with PATS

Product: Trap-Eye™ unburdens growers from sticky trap scouting using wireless devices that identify and count insects to provide a complete population overview
Product Description: Scouting is the first crucial step of a successful IPM. Trap-Eye™ fully automates sticky trap monitoring. It uses a dense network of scouting devices to take pictures of sticky traps, which our artificial neural network analysed to count pests and beneficial insects. This provides profitable, accurate, and high-density scouting data to make better IPM decisions anytime and anywhere.
In the jury comments, Heistek says: “A strong collaboration with a startup and an innovative combination of technology and biology. A very impressive and rapid product development journey from concept to a market-ready product. With this winner, the jury expects a major contribution to sustainability.”

The exhibition is a global meeting place for all horticultural technology professionals, focusing on the early stages of the horticultural chain and the current issues growers face. The International Association of Horticultural Producers – AIPH, has approved the event as an International Horticultural Trade Expo. AVAG, the industry association for the greenhouse technology sector in the Netherlands, supports GreenTech.
